                  Originally posted by Panici
                  What TLC are you giving to the M42? I see the intake manifold is off.
                  Eliminating the “mess” of hoses under the intake. Coolant and Vent ones. Also just changing them out because some are brittle and I wanted to avoid any leaks. Throttle was having a bit of a choke but still sat at 1krpm range at idle. Either way I wanted also clean out the injectors and basically anything I’m removing.

                  I also need to do the valve cover gasket and add some timeserts for some of the valve cover threads. Unfortunately some are stripped and so the bolts are just free floating.

                  Want to have something to drive around for fun but also wanted to not ride that bad. So will also be doing some suspension stuff too. After the regular maintenance stuff.
